I may be slow on the uptake here, but this week I have noticed somthing very worrying to me.....
Rating stars seem to be apearing on my tracks, without me applying them!
I have searched the help file and google for info about "AIMP ratings", and I have not found a clear explination for whats happening here.
Please can you explain ?
I am seeing that AIMP has a "Ratings" data field, which it seems to self populate with a number bewteen 1-5.
and that figure seems to be displayed as hollow stars, in the exact location I would expect to see my own rating stars applied.
This is horriffic to me, as someone who acutally uses the ratings feature as part of how I organise and select tracks.
perhaps your use of "Rating" is wrong here ? becuase the software has no idea what i think of any given track.
you have a play count, and info about wheather I skipped to the end , or skipped to another track ... etc. but that does not inform you of my feelings towards the track in any way.
I may already be familure with it, and ready to move on.
I may love it and play it reguarly, but not consider it to be live set material. in which event i would be applying a low rating. even if i actually love it.
I could go on.. but i hope you understand my point already.
I would much rather this were not happening. I have used my own Ratings system for many years, seeing fantom ratings appear in my track list is kinda jarring .
I appericate that you have tried to seperate the two ratings by using slightly different star icons. but they are not different enough.
and the appear in the same display space.
Even if they were totally differenty colours, I would maintian that you have no right nor information to be applying "ratings" to my music anyway. I find it very arrogant, becuase how can any software possibley rate anyting on my behalf.
you have information like;
Play count .. .and plays this week / month / year, etc.
but AIMP has nothing that directly measures how I feel about a Track.
But a "Rating" is not somthing that your software can self declare.
It may not even be me listerning and using the PC.
I would be greatful if you could explain to me what this is meant to be , and how I can turn it off. or control it.
I ask you to consider removing or adjusting it, so that it does no interfeer with the actual USER ratings system, which many people have been using for a very long time.
